Call of Duty: Black Ops 6 is experiencing a frustrating "Join Failed Because You Are on a Different Version" error, preventing players from joining friends' matches. Here's how to resolve this issue.

Troubleshooting the Black Ops 6 Version Mismatch Error

Official Screenshot of Adler in Call Of Duty Black Ops 6 addressing the version mismatch error.The error indicates your game isn't fully updated. Returning to the main menu and allowing the game to update should fix it. However, many players report the error persists even after attempting this.

Restarting the game is the next troubleshooting step. This forces a fresh update check. While it means a short delay, it's a simple solution worth trying. Ask your friends to wait briefly.

If the problem continues, try this workaround: When encountering the error, initiating a match search sometimes allows your friends to join your party. This may require several attempts, but it's a potential solution.
